Transaction 3048e1863888327740517c5470a83ce51561a3a69c8627c05cbf1e60b0fd84f9

5 Input
2 Outputs
  • 3048e1863888327740517c5470a83ce51561a3a69c8627c05cbf1e60b0fd84f9:0
  • value  13360000
    address  1QLaHmRfyPuXiAKpT8Wm3kZ4WbVuubWKDe
  • 3048e1863888327740517c5470a83ce51561a3a69c8627c05cbf1e60b0fd84f9:1
  • value  969391
    address  15qgNcucwig46Ut85mhYqo3jKexfdi7JdR